Triangle: Blair/Max/Skye
Skye arrived in Llanview with destruction on her mind. When her efforts to break up Ben and Viki's relationship failed, Skye set her sights on Max. She soon learned of Max and Blair's Buchanan-identity scam, and realized Max was faking his amnesia -- giving her all the ammunition she would need to blackmail Max right into her bed. Though the affair was brief, we are still feeling the effects.

Snip and Dip: Skye and Blair
OLTL put Dynasty's Alexis and Krystal to shame when Blair found out about Skye's affair with Max. After Blair flushed Skye's head in the toilet, Skye retaliated by drugging Max and Blair and then chopping off Blair's gorgeous locks. Makes getting tossed in a pool seem positively playful!

Back Where He Belongs: Roger Howarth
Howarth may be TV's most reluctant soap star, but he's certainly one of the most appreciated. Fans clamored for his return when he was gone; now their only gripe is he isn't on screen enough.

Hit Haircut: OLTL's Blair
Kassie DePaiva was overdue for a new look. Her decision to radically alter her appearance via a haircut undoubtedly took a lot of thought, and OLTL was able to incorporate it into the storyline. Kassie, you've never looked better!
